Avatar uživatele
anonym

Kdo umí v C#??

Potřebuji, abych v konzolových aplikacích, kde jsem si načetl text s textem mohl pracovat a to následovně: změnit velikost písmen tak, aby počáteční písmeno slova bylo velké a ostatní malé a naopak (počáteční malé a ostatní velké) a za druhý, abych mohl písmena přeházet.. Př.: slovo ⇒ lvoos

Uzamčená otázka

ohodnoťte nejlepší odpověď symbolem palce

Zajímavá 1Pro koho je otázka zajímavá? annas před 5352 dny Sledovat Nahlásit



Nejlepší odpověď
Avatar uživatele
Shurik

S velikostí písmen:
System.Globali­zation.Culture­Info.CurrentCul­ture.TextInfo­.ToTitleCase(Strin­g);

K tomu přeházení písmen:
Jednotlivý znak stringu můžeš získat přístupem přes index stringu. např. Var[5], číslováno od nuly. Pak už se stačí s tím akorát pohrát dle libosti.

Zdroj: channel9.msdn­.com/forums/TechOf­f/252814-Howto-Capitalize-first-char-of-words-in-a-string-NETC/

0 Nominace Nahlásit

Otázka nemá žádné další odpovědi.



Diskuze k otázce

U otázky nebylo diskutováno.

Nový příspěvek
Zajímavé otázky v kategorii Počítače a internet